How is the IELTS Speaking Test graded?
The IELTS Speaking Test is graded on 4 requirements: fluency and coherence, lexical resource, grammatical range and precision, and pronunciation.
2. Can I use notes during the Speaking Test?
No, candidates are not allowed to use notes or any other help during the Speaking Test.
3. What should I do if I don't comprehend a question?
If you do not comprehend a question, it is perfectly acceptable to ask the examiner to repeat or clarify it.
4. The length of time is the Speaking Test?
The Speaking Test usually lasts in between 11 to 14 minutes.
